About Idaho County Light & Power

Idaho County Light & Power is headquartered in Grangeville, Idaho and provides electricity in 8 cities in the state. The provider has 4,296 customers. There are 21 industrial customer accounts, 329 commercial customers and 3,946 residential accounts. Idaho County Light & Power's consumers are billed an average residential electricity price of 12.14 cents per kilowatt hour, which is 22.97% less than the national average rate of 15.76 cents. In 2019 the company had retail sales of 54,225 megawatt hours and wholesale sales to other companies of 54,225 megawatt hours. Power generation facilities owned by Idaho County Light & Power generated 4.38% of the megawatt hours sourced by the provider and an additional 95.62% was procured by way of wholesale channels. In 2019 they had total electricity related revenue of $6,410,900, with 93.80% coming from retail sales and 2.21% from wholesale customers.

The average residential power bill for a consumer of Idaho County Light & Power is $123.7. The company currently does not produce their own electricity. Instead, they must purchase that electricity at wholesale prices from other providers and then resell it to end users.

Idaho County Light & Power Net Metering

Idaho County Light & Power is one of 12 electric providers in the state who offer net metering to their consumers. Net metering allows residents to sell wattage back to the grid, which makes the installation of solar and other electricity sources a cheaper project.
